引言
SUSE Linux Enterprise Server 11 Service Pack 3 (SUSE 11 SP3) 是一个强大的企业级操作系统,它提供了丰富的命令行工具和终端功能。掌握SUSE 11 SP3的终端是系统管理员和开发者必备的技能。本文将详细介绍SUSE 11 SP3终端的使用,从基础命令到高级技巧,帮助您从入门到精通。
第1章:SUSE 11 SP3终端基础
1.1 登录终端
在SUSE 11 SP3系统中,您可以通过以下几种方式登录终端:
- 使用图形界面中的终端模拟器。
- 使用SSH远程登录。
- 直接在物理机器上按下Ctrl+Alt+F2等功能键进入文本模式。
1.2 基本命令
以下是一些基本的SUSE 11 SP3终端命令:
ls:列出目录中的文件和文件夹。cd:更改当前工作目录。pwd:显示当前工作目录的路径。mkdir:创建新的目录。rm:删除文件或目录。cp:复制文件或目录。mv:移动或重命名文件或目录。
1.3 文件权限和所有权
chmod:更改文件或目录的权限。chown:更改文件或目录的所有者。chgrp:更改文件或目录的所属组。
第2章:文件编辑和查看
2.1 文件编辑器
SUSE 11 SP3提供了多种文件编辑器,如vi、nano和gedit。
vi:一个经典的文本编辑器,具有丰富的功能和强大的编辑模式。nano:一个更易于使用的文本编辑器,具有简单的命令行界面。gedit:一个图形界面的文本编辑器。
2.2 文件查看
cat:显示文件内容。less:分页查看文件内容。head:显示文件的前几行。tail:显示文件的最后几行。
第3章:进程管理
3.1 进程查看
ps:显示当前系统运行的进程。top:动态显示系统资源使用情况和进程信息。
3.2 进程控制
kill:发送信号给进程。nice:设置进程的优先级。renice:调整进程的优先级。
第4章:包管理
4.1 Yast包管理器
SUSE 11 SP3使用Yast作为包管理器,它允许您安装、更新和删除软件包。
yast:启动Yast包管理器。zypper:命令行包管理工具。
4.2 RPM包管理
rpm:管理RPM软件包的工具。rpm -i:安装RPM包。rpm -e:删除RPM包。
第5章:网络配置
5.1 网络配置文件
SUSE 11 SP3使用ifcfg文件来配置网络接口。
/etc/sysconfig/network/ifcfg-eth0:以太网接口配置文件。
5.2 网络服务
systemctl:控制网络服务的启动和停止。nmcli:NetworkManager命令行工具。
第6章:安全配置
6.1 用户和组管理
useradd:创建新用户。groupadd:创建新组。usermod:修改用户信息。groupmod:修改组信息。
6.2 权限控制
setfacl:设置文件或目录的访问控制列表。setsebool:修改SELinux布尔值。
第7章:高级技巧
7.1 自动化脚本
使用bash编写脚本来自动化日常任务。
7.2 系统监控
使用sysstat、nmon等工具监控系统性能。
7.3 虚拟化
使用libvirt和QEMU进行虚拟化。
结语
通过本文的详细讲解,您应该已经掌握了SUSE 11 SP3终端的基本操作和高级技巧。这些技能将帮助您更高效地管理SUSE服务器,解决日常工作中遇到的问题。继续实践和学习,您将成为一名真正的SUSE终端高手。